Default 89 240DL hard starts,barely idles and dies with throttle

fixed a leaky rear main seal on a good running 240 dl only to have the car become hard starting and barely able to idle. Acts as if its fuel starved. I can get it idle on all four but seems to heat up quickly as if its lean and slowly dies. Checked the fuel pumps, jumped the left side of the #4 and #6 fuse car runs the same, you can hear the fuel pump. Pulled the lines off the filter and blows threw easily. No codes thrown. Everything went smoothly with the removal and install of the transmission nothing was binding. The battery was unhooked to remove the starter. Gas tank was near empty when I pulled into the garage (Daughters car) Jacked back and front of car three foot off ground, might of shook up the gas tank debris. The only thing I can think off is I might of bumped the crank sensor positioner, but the car starts. Rectifying wheel off a notch? timing advanced? I will have to get a fuel pressure tester tonight and see what the pressure is. Any other ideas?

did u put the flywheel on correctly? it goes only 1 way. check the timing, it's probably off due to the fw position.... also, if your crankshaft pulley is separating, you will get similar results after a motor/trans separation.

40lbs fuel pressure. the crankshaft positioner sensor wires where crushed but still connected. Cant get any ohms out of the center and side connections. New one ordered. How do I check the timing when it wont stay running anymore? I cant see that I messed up and put the fly wheel on wrong.. If the new CSP dosent start it can I back/forth the timing to get it to run to figure out if the fly wheel is off a notch?

The fly wheel wasnt indexed right..Ended up having to pull the trans again..everything is groovy....
